How do we COVID-19 and ski at the same time? COVID -19 stress is real. Parents, coaches and athletes all coping with stress differently. Resort staff is likely to have multiple stress points, work with the resort whenever possible. Know the symptoms, stay home if questionable. Do your best to disarm tense situations. Covid means masks… all the time. Keep extra face masks, layers, goggles and sanitizer with you.
COLDEST DAYS… And lunch Pay attention to weather reports. Dress appropriately! No cotton kids, please. Extra layers, heated boots, hand warmers and keeping the blood moving is our refuge from the cold… Hiking rails is fun! Coldest of days, practice schedule will be modified. No lodges for lunch, pack smart lunches… You CANNOT buy a lunch this winter and stay with the team for practice. When possible, Woodward Barn.
USASA/FIS events Paul with USASA and US Ski and Snowboard are working to have a schedule posted ASAP Expect new competition formats, expedited heats and groupings that keep team’s together Value training days over competition days this year
